The Master of Innovation
Ki Manteb Sudarsono wasn't just a performer; he was an innovator who constantly sought to revitalize wayang kulit and make it relevant to contemporary audiences. He boldly experimented with modern technology, incorporating elements like electronic music and special effects into his performances. While some traditionalists initially raised eyebrows, Ki Manteb argued that these innovations were necessary to attract younger generations and ensure the survival of wayang kulit in a rapidly changing world. This forward-thinking approach earned him both admiration and respect within the artistic community.
One of his most notable innovations was his use of more dynamic and theatrical staging. He moved beyond the traditional static backdrop, incorporating elaborate sets, lighting effects, and even pyrotechnics to enhance the visual spectacle of his performances. He also introduced new characters and storylines, drawing inspiration from contemporary events and social issues. This willingness to address modern themes in his performances made wayang kulit more accessible and engaging for audiences who might not have been familiar with the traditional epics.
Moreover, Ki Manteb was a pioneer in using computerized sound and lighting systems in his shows, a move that significantly enhanced the immersive experience. He understood that to keep wayang kulit alive, it had to evolve and adapt to the times. A Cultural Ambassador
Beyond his performances in Indonesia, Ki Manteb Sudarsono served as a cultural ambassador, introducing wayang kulit to audiences around the world. He toured extensively, performing in countries across Asia, Europe, and North America. These international performances not only showcased the beauty and artistry of wayang kulit but also helped to promote Indonesian culture and heritage on a global stage. He was a true representative of his nation, sharing the rich traditions of his homeland with people from all walks of life.
During his international tours, Ki Manteb often conducted workshops and masterclasses, teaching aspiring puppeteers and students about the art of wayang kulit. He was passionate about sharing his knowledge and expertise, ensuring that the tradition would be passed on to future generations. His dedication to education and cultural exchange earned him numerous accolades and cemented his reputation as a leading figure in the world of traditional arts.
